Famous Anti-Japanese General Liu Guiwu Beheaded by Japanese Army - His Head Remains Publicly Displayed in Japan to This Day

Anti-Japanese General Liu Guiwu (1902-1938), native of Chaoyang, Liaoning, led his forces in bloody battles with the Japanese army on the Suiyuan front after the July 7 Incident. He died in battle in 1938 at Huangyouganzigou Village, Wuchuan County, at age 36. According to reports, his head was severed by the Japanese army and remains displayed as a war trophy in an exhibition hall in Japan to this day, while his remains were buried in Xi'an.
